Background
The contract is for Grand Jury and Deposition Court Reporting Services for the United States Attorney's Office (USAO) for the Middle District of Florida (Jacksonville). The period of performance includes a base year from October 1, 2022, to September 30, 2023, with four one-year options. The contract will be an Indefinite Delivery Indefinite Quantity (IDIQ) contract with a Time and Material (T&M) contract type. The Department of Labor wage rates are applicable, and the contractor shall provide a minimum number of required court reporters and videographers.

Work Details
The contractor is required to provide all labor, material, equipment, facilities, and other necessary resources to record and transcribe Grand Jury and Deposition testimony on an 'as needed' basis for the USAO. The contractor must also schedule Grand Jury transcripts, provide original transcripts within specified turnaround times, and ensure that all transcripts contain specific information such as witness name, date, time of the proceeding, attorney details, and case number.
Additionally, the contractor must adhere to specific requirements for attendance at Grand Jury sessions and deposition proceedings.
